What is FHA EEM Agreement

The FHA EEM Energy Report Request Agreement is a document used by home buyers to request the SBRA to determine the allowable mortgage increase under the FHA Energy Efficient Mortgage program.

What is the FHA EEM Energy Report Request Agreement?

The FHA EEM Energy Report Request Agreement is a crucial document within the realm of real estate transactions. It serves as a formal request for the Systems Building Research Alliance (SBRA) to determine the allowable increase in mortgage amount under the Federal Housing Authority’s Energy Efficient Mortgage (EEM) program. This agreement not only facilitates the process of evaluating energy efficiency but also ensures homebuyers can effectively manage their mortgage amounts.

Purpose and Benefits of the FHA EEM Energy Report Request Agreement

This agreement is essential for homeowners seeking to enhance their mortgage potential. By utilizing the FHA EEM Energy Report Request Agreement, buyers can request an increase in their mortgage amounts based on anticipated energy savings. Consequently, this benefits homebuyers by enabling precise estimation of energy costs, fostering financial planning and ultimately leading to substantial savings in the long run.

Key Features of the FHA EEM Energy Report Request Agreement

Several key characteristics define the FHA EEM Energy Report Request Agreement:
  • Includes necessary fields for signatures, dates, and personal information.
  • Involves a fee structure set at $250 for each energy report provided by SBRA.
  • Incorporates the energy star package agreement as a significant component.

Yes, the requester must agree to pay SBRA a fee of $250 for each home for which a Manufactured Home Energy Report is provided. Ensure that this fee is included in your budget when applying.
